I have an unusual problem. I seem to have finally gotten everything up and running with your template. I did have to go in and make the changes you suggested with the wp-config lines of code: ini_set(‘memory_limit’,’256M’);ini_set(‘max_execution_time’,600);… everything seems to be working on the site itself. I can visit the site without any problems and the page loads fine. However, whenever I try to edit a page within wordpress it gives me a 500 error. I can’t edit the sample pages provided in your demo. I am able to create from scratch in visual composer an entirely new page, but once the page is saved I am unable to edit that page. It provides a 500 error whenever I try to do the standard edit, as well as the edit with visual composer. Any suggestions?

I’m very sorry but this is the error coming from your server. Please check it if there is something wrong with it.Server Requirements for Importing Demo Data: https://jwsuperthemes.com/forums/topic/server-requirements-importing-demo-data/
Set max_execution_time = 180 seconds or more
file_upload_max_size = 16MB (It will also help during theme installation from admin Dashboard if you have set file upload size limit to 16 MB)
memory_limit = 256MBLess Design Option should enable before changing color.
